To assist, the European Commission is reviewing, and where necessary updating, the over 100 sector-specific stakeholder ‘preparedness notices’ it published during the Article 50 negotiations with the United Kingdom.
An updated so-called ‘notice for readiness’ for the Chemicals sector has been issued and can be found underneath.
All interested parties are reminded of the legal situation applicable as of the end of the transition period whether a future partnership agreement is concluded or not.
The notice also explains certain rules of the withdrawal agreement where relevant as well as the rules applicable to Northern Ireland as of the end of the transition period.
